Uncovering Hidden Fees and Charges

One of the most surprising aspects of What Your Bank Account Isn’t Telling You is the revelation of hidden fees and charges that may be eating away at users’ savings. From overdraft fees to monthly maintenance charges, these expenses can add up quickly and negatively impact financial stability. By exploring the details of one’s bank account, individuals can identify these fees and take steps to minimize or eliminate them.

A recent study found that, on average, individuals pay around $100 per year in hidden fees, with some users paying upwards of $500. While this may seem like a small amount, it can add up over time and have a significant impact on overall financial health.
